@charset "utf-8";
/* CSS Document */
*{margin:0;padding:0}
html,body,h1,h2,h3,h4,h5,h6,div,dl,dt,dd,ul,ol,li,p,blockquote,pre,hr,figure,table,caption,th,td,form,fieldset,legend,input,button,textarea,menu{margin:0;padding:0;}
header,footer,section,article,aside,nav,hgroup,address,figure,figcaption,menu,details{display:block;}
table{border-collapse:collapse;border-spacing:0;}
caption,th{text-align:left;font-weight:normal;}
html,body,fieldset,img,iframe,abbr{border:0;}
i,cite,em,var,address,dfn{font-style:normal;}
[hidefocus],summary{outline:0;}
ul,ol,li{list-style:none;}
h1,h2,h3,h4,h5,h6,small{font-size:100%;}
sup,sub{font-size:83%;}
pre,code,kbd,samp{font-family:inherit;}
q:before,q:after{content:none;}
textarea{overflow:auto;resize:none;}
label,summary{cursor:default;}
a,button{cursor:pointer;}
h1,h2,h3,h4,h5,h6,strong,b{font-weight:normal;}
del,ins,u,s,a,a:hover{text-decoration:none;}
body,textarea,input,button,select,keygen,legend{font:12px/1.14 arial,\5b8b\4f53;color:#333;outline:0;}
body{background:#fff;}
a{color:#333;}
a{text-decoration:none;}
em,i{ font-style:normal;}
img {border: 0 none; width: auto\9; height: auto; max-width: 100%; vertical-align: top; -ms-interpolation-mode: bicubic; display:block;}

body { max-width:16rem; margin: 0 auto;font-family:'微软雅黑'; overflow: hidden; background:#fff; overflow-y: scroll;}

.top{ width:15rem; padding:0.5rem 0.6rem 0.25rem; overflow:hidden; }
.top_l{float:left;background:url(../images/logo.png) no-repeat; background-size:contain; width:7rem; height:1.5rem;}
.top_r{float:right;background:url(../images/tel.png) no-repeat; background-size:contain; width:5.25rem; height:1.5rem;}

.nav{line-height:0.6rem; height:1.45rem; overflow:hidden; background-color:#e40177;}
.nav a{float:left; color:#fff; line-height:1.45rem; font-size:0.5rem; padding:0 0.275rem;}

.banner{background:url(../images/banner.jpg) no-repeat center center; width:16rem; height:9.65rem;}

.dy{width:15.1rem; margin:0.9rem auto 0.8rem;}
.dy p{width:13.3rem; padding-left:1.7rem; background:url(../images/dy_l.png) no-repeat left top; background-size:1.2rem 3.25rem; min-height:3.25rem; font-size:0.45rem; color:#000; line-height:0.65rem; text-indent:2em; margin-bottom:0.55rem;}
.dy p em,.dy p a{color:#e02c53;}
.dy img{width:15.1rem; height:4.85rem;}

.title{width:15rem; height:2rem; margin:0 auto;}
.btn{display:block; width:11.45rem; height:1.325rem; margin:0.7rem auto 1rem;}
.btn img{width:11.45rem; height:1.325rem;}

.box_1{width:15.15rem; margin:0 auto 0.8rem;}
.box_1 p{font-size:0.45rem; color:#000; line-height:0.65rem; text-indent:2em; margin:0.2rem 0 0.6rem;}
.box_1 .one{width:15.15rem; height:9.95rem;}
.box_1 .two{width:15.15rem; height:4.375rem;}

.box_2{width:15.15rem; margin:0.45rem auto 0;}
.box_2x{overflow:hidden}
.box_2x li{float:left; width:4.875rem; cursor:pointer; padding:0.4rem 0; margin-right:0.25rem;}
.box_2x li img{width:2.55rem; height:1.925rem; margin:0 auto;}
.box_2nr{width:15.15rem;height:7.675rem; margin-top:0.5rem;}
.box_2nr img{width:15.15rem;height:7.675rem;}
.xz{background-color:#fb5b32;}
.yc{background-color:#c4c4c4;}

.box_3bg{background-color:#f1f1ef; padding:0.7rem 0 0.6rem; margin-bottom:0.85rem;}
.box_3{width:15.15rem; margin:0.45rem auto 0;}
.box_3x{overflow:hidden; margin-top:0.5rem;}
.box_3x li{float:left; width:4.475rem; cursor:pointer; padding:0.1rem 0.2rem; margin-right:0.25rem; background-color:#e02c53; overflow:hidden;}
.box_3x li img{width:1.975rem; height:1.975rem; float:left;}
.box_3x li p{float:right; width:2.1rem; font-size:0.6rem; font-weight:bold; margin-top:0.35rem;}
.box_3x li p em{font-size:0.45rem;}
.box_3nr{width:15.15rem;height:7.675rem; margin-top:0.5rem;}
.box_3nr img{width:15.15rem;height:7.65rem;}
.xz_a{color:#ffcc00;}
.yc_c{color:#fff;}

.box_4 img{width:15.15rem; height:7.675rem; margin:0.45rem auto 0;}
.box_5 img{width:15.15rem; height:8rem; margin:0.45rem auto 0;}

.box_6{width:16rem; height:13.8rem; overflow:hidden; margin:0.4rem auto 0;}
.bt{width:16rem; height:1.825rem; background-size:contain; background-repeat:no-repeat; margin-bottom:0.5rem;}
.content{width:15.175rem; height:8.7rem; margin:0 auto 0.6rem;}
.xz_e{background-image:url(../images/6_zk.png);}
.yc_d{background-image:url(../images/6_sq.png);}
	/* 本例子css -------------------------------------- */
	.focus1{ width:15.175rem; height:8.7rem;  margin:0 auto; position:relative; overflow:hidden;   }
	.focus1 .hd{ width:100%; height:0.4rem;  position:absolute; z-index:1; bottom:0.6rem; text-align:right;  }
	.focus1 .hd ul{ display:inline-block; height:0.3rem; padding:0.1rem 0.15rem; -webkit-border-radius:0.15rem; -moz-border-radius:0.15rem; border-radius:0.15rem; font-size:0; vertical-align:top;	}
	.focus1 .hd ul li{ display:inline-block; width:0.3rem; height:0.3rem; -webkit-border-radius:0.15rem; -moz-border-radius:0.15rem; border-radius:0.15rem; background:#000; margin:0 0.125rem;  vertical-align:top; overflow:hidden;   }
	.focus1 .hd ul .on{ background:#fff;  }

	.focus1 .bd{ position:relative; z-index:0; }
	.focus1 .bd li img{ width:100%;  height:8.7rem; background:url(images/loading.gif) center center no-repeat;  }
	.focus1 .bd li a{ -webkit-tap-highlight-color:rgba(0, 0, 0, 0); /* 取消链接高亮 */  }

	.focus2{ width:15.175rem; height:8.7rem;  margin:0 auto; position:relative; overflow:hidden;   }
	.focus2 .hd{ width:100%; height:0.4rem;  position:absolute; z-index:1; bottom:0.6rem; text-align:right;  }
	.focus2 .hd ul{ display:inline-block; height:0.3rem; padding:0.1rem 0.15rem; -webkit-border-radius:0.15rem; -moz-border-radius:0.15rem; border-radius:0.15rem; font-size:0; vertical-align:top;	}
	.focus2 .hd ul li{ display:inline-block; width:0.3rem; height:0.3rem; -webkit-border-radius:0.15rem; -moz-border-radius:0.15rem; border-radius:0.15rem; background:#000; margin:0 0.125rem;  vertical-align:top; overflow:hidden;   }
	.focus2 .hd ul .on{ background:#fff;  }

	.focus2 .bd{ position:relative; z-index:0; }
	.focus2 .bd li img{ width:100%;  height:8.7rem; background:url(images/loading.gif) center center no-repeat;  }
	.focus2 .bd li a{ -webkit-tap-highlight-color:rgba(0, 0, 0, 0); /* 取消链接高亮 */  }




.bot{height:7rem; background-color:#e02c53;}
.bot img{width:7.5rem; height:1.55rem; margin:0 auto; padding:1.1rem 0 0.2rem;}
.bot p{font-size:0.5rem; text-align:center; line-height:1rem; color:#fff;}
